Ershad finally laid to rest in Rangpur

Rangpur Correspondent: Former President and Jatiya Party Chairman Hussein Muhammad Ershad was finally laid to eternal rest in his hometown Rangpur on Tuesday.

He was buried at the grave dug by his party followers at the Litchi Orchard of his Polli Nibash around 6:00pm.

Huge army personnel took position around the prepared grave before the burial to maintain discipline as thousands of people gathered there to bid farewell to their beloved leader.

Military men carried ex-army chief Ershad’s coffin, draped in an Army flag, to near the grave. Later, a life sketch of the Jatiya Party Chairman was read out before observing a one-minute silence showing tributes to him.

Earlier, the fourth and final namaz-e-janaza of Jatiya Party Chairman HM Ershad was held at Central Collectorate Eidgah around 2:00pm with the participation of thousands of people.

Huge law enforcers were deployed in and around the Eidgah to fend off any untoward incident as local leaders announced to thwart party senior leader’s plan to bury Ershad at Military Graveyard in the capital instead of Rangpur.

On Sunday, Jatiya Party secretary general Moshiur Rahman Ranga announced that their chairperson will be buried at the military graveyard in the capital.

Protesting the decision, Jatiya party’s Rangpur and Rajshahi units held a joint meeting at the party’s Rangpur city unit office on Monday decided to bury Ershad in Rangpur at any cost. They later prepared a grave at Polli Nibash.
